Assessment of health related quality of life of drug resistant tuberculosis patients

Journal Title: Indian Journal of Pharmacy and Pharmacology - Year 2018, Vol 5, Issue 2

Abstract

Objectives Assessment of Health Related Quality of Life HRQoL of drug resistant tuberculosis patients at the start of treatment under PMDT regimeMaterials and Methods This observational study was conducted on a cohort of 172 drugresistant tuberculosis DRTB patients at the time of registration under PMDT regime Patients who started their treatment between January 2016 and December 2016 were included in the study after approval from IEC A validated WHOQOLBREF questionnaire was used for interviewing the patients This questionnaire assesses HRQoL on 0100 transforming scale in four domains Physical Psychological Social relationship and EnvironmentalResults Out of 172 participants 50 291 were females and 122709 were males Their mean ageSD was 40231577 years 779 participants were married 977 of them were residing in rural areas Most of the participants were from district Mandi 331 and Kangra 209 Scores of Physical domain were 39761388 Psychological domain were 37231489 Social relationship domain were 43281348 and Environment domain were 5066913 Overall HRQoL scores were 42731011 Conclusion Chronic diseases like tuberculosis affect all domains of HRQoL and there is need to consider HRQoL domains of patients of DRTB along with smear positivity and mortality to evaluate the success of any national heath programmeKeywordsDrug resistant tuberculosis Health related quality of life WHOQOL BREF
